About The Brunel Centre
The Brunel Centre is a business and economic data, research and knowledge exchange centre for the West of England, formed as an innovative university-business partnership. It provides the data, research and knowledge needed to support sustainable and inclusive economic growth in the West of England and to enable the region to capitalise on the opportunities of devolution working across multiple political and administrative boundaries. Through its activities and outputs, the Brunel Centre is supporting decision-makers at different levels of government to co-create private and public strategies that enable local growth planning and further devolution of power to the West of England. The Brunel Centre is a partnership between UWE Bristol, University of Bath and Futures West and funded by the UKRI Research England Development Fund.
